Water - Lifeline for Living Organisms

Water is the life-line for all living organisms on earth as it is an essential constituent of all living beings. All living organism have their metabolism, which necessarily depends on the physical as well as chemical properties of water.Water also forms the habitat for innumerous organisms on earth.

Aquatic systems such as freshwater and marine realms support luxuriant growth of plants and animals,including the microscopic and macroscopic ones.Adequate supply of water is essential to sustain a healthy environment because it is an important constituent of the protoplasm in all-living organisms.An estimate reveals that if a man lives for a life span of 70 years, he needs at least 750,000 tonnes of water for his survival.

Water available on Earth:

The quantum of water on earth has been estimated as 10 power 15 acre-feet.Of this, 97.6% is in the oceans and therefore, not potable.Only 2.4% (approximately 1.4 billion kilo meter cube) or 33 X 10 to the power of 12 acre-feet is fresh water of which more than 1.9 % remains frozen in the polar regions and in the glaciers.The ground water available is 0.5%; of which 0.1% is available in soil as moisture and 0.2% is available in lakes and streams(0.126 million kilo meter cube) remaining found as such. About 14% of the ground water is at depths between 2,500 and 12,000 feet and only around 11% of groundwater is available at depths less than 2,500 feet.Globally, over 70% of water is utilized for agriculture only. Of this, Over 90% is utilized by the developing countries.
